Transaction 239626316646e7b79304b10e88af0dca4403393c50d4c10a8693f1f481afbd02

94 Input
2 Outputs
  • 239626316646e7b79304b10e88af0dca4403393c50d4c10a8693f1f481afbd02:0
  • value  913740
    address  33XwA9ptCSs4EhRuhLVjEVBA9vhgMRHixD
  • 239626316646e7b79304b10e88af0dca4403393c50d4c10a8693f1f481afbd02:1
  • value  1957116013
    address  3DA9ToTYDSsvHiwuSeNLYRjz1eVhK9zijB